What is a electrocardiograph technician​
Veronika [31]
Electrocardiograph (EKG or ECG) technicians operate equipment that measures, monitors, and graphically traces the electrical activity of the heart. Physicians use the graph (electrocardiogram/EKG/ECG) to diagnose and monitor patients' heart problems.

Why is it important to get enough iron in your diet
Serhud [2]

This is because iron is used to make a protein called hemoglobin. This protein helps blood cells carry oxygen around the body.
